Children living with perinatally acquired HIV (CLWH) survive into adulthood on antiretroviral therapy (ART). HIV, ART, and malnutrition can all lead to low bone mineral density (BMD). Few studies have described bone health among CLWH in Sub-Saharan Africa. We determined the prevalence and factors associated with low BMD among CLWH switching to second-line ART in the CHAPAS-4 trial (ISRCTN22964075) in Uganda.
BMD was determined using dual-energy X-ray Absorptiometry (DXA). BMD Z-scores were adjusted for age, sex, height and race. Demographic characteristics were summarized using median interquartile range (IQR) for continuous variables and proportions for categorical variables. Logistic regression was used to determine the associations between each variable and low BMD.
A total of 159 children were enrolled (50% male) with median age (IQR) 10 (7-12) years, median duration of first -line ART 5.2(3.3-6.8) years; CD4 count 774 (528-1083) cells/mm3, weight-for-age Z-score -1.36 (-2.19, -0.65) and body mass index Z-score (BMIZ) -1.31 (-2.06, -0.6). Low (Z-score≤ -2) total body less head (TBLH) BMD was observed in 28 (18%) children, 21(13%) had low lumbar spine (LS) BMD, and15 (9%) had both. Low TBLH BMD was associated with increasing age (adjusted odds ratio [aOR] 1.37; 95% CI: 1.13-1.65, p = 0.001), female sex (aOR: 3.8; 95% CL: 1.31-10.81, p = 0.014), low BMI (aOR 0.36:95% CI: 0.21-0.61, p<0.001), and first-line zidovudine exposure (aOR: 3.68; 95% CI: 1.25-10.8, p = 0.018). CD4 count, viral load and first- line ART duration were not associated with TBLH BMD. Low LS BMD was associated with increasing age (aOR 1.42; 95% CI: 1.16-1.74, p = 0.001) and female sex: (aOR 3.41; 95% CI: 1.18-9.8, p = 0.023).
Nearly 20% CLWH failing first-line ART had low BMD which was associated with female sex, older age, first-line ZDV exposure, and low BMI. Prevention, monitoring, and implications following transition to adult care should be prioritized to identify poor bone health in HIV+adolescents entering adulthood.

Published estimates of mortality and progression to AIDS as children with HIV approach adulthood are limited. We describe rates and risk factors for death and AIDS-defining events in children and adolescents after initiation of combination antiretroviral therapy (cART) in 17 middle- and high-income countries, including some in Western and Central Europe (W&CE), Eastern Europe (Russia and Ukraine), and Thailand.
Children with perinatal HIV aged <18 years initiating cART were followed until their 21st birthday, transfer to adult care, death, loss to follow-up, or last visit up until 31 December 2013. Rates of death and first AIDS-defining events were calculated. Baseline and time-updated risk factors for early/late (≤/>6 months of cART) death and progression to AIDS were assessed. Of 3,526 children included, 32% were from the United Kingdom or Ireland, 30% from elsewhere in W&CE, 18% from Russia or Ukraine, and 20% from Thailand. At cART initiation, median age was 5.2 (IQR 1.4-9.3) years; 35% of children aged <5 years had a CD4 lymphocyte percentage <15% in 1997-2003, which fell to 15% of children in 2011 onwards (p < 0.001). Similarly, 53% and 18% of children ≥5 years had a CD4 count <200 cells/mm3 in 1997-2003 and in 2011 onwards, respectively (p < 0.001). Median follow-up was 5.6 (2.9-8.7) years. Of 94 deaths and 237 first AIDS-defining events, 43 (46%) and 100 (42%) were within 6 months of initiating cART, respectively. Multivariable predictors of early death were: being in the first year of life; residence in Russia, Ukraine, or Thailand; AIDS at cART start; initiating cART on a nonnucleoside reverse transcriptase inhibitor (NNRTI)-based regimen; severe immune suppression; and low BMI-for-age z-score. Current severe immune suppression, low current BMI-for-age z-score, and current viral load >400 c/mL predicted late death. Predictors of early and late progression to AIDS were similar. Study limitations include incomplete recording of US Centers for Disease Control (CDC) disease stage B events and serious adverse events in some countries; events that were distributed over a long time period, and that we lacked power to analyse trends in patterns and causes of death over time.
In our study, 3,526 children and adolescents with perinatal HIV infection initiated antiretroviral therapy (ART) in countries in Europe and Thailand. We observed that over 40% of deaths occurred ≤6 months after cART initiation. Greater early mortality risk in infants, as compared to older children, and in Russia, Ukraine, or Thailand as compared to W&CE, raises concern. Current severe immune suppression, being underweight, and unsuppressed viral load were associated with a higher risk of death at >6 months after initiation of cART.

Background
The aim of this study was to compare quantitative ultrasound (QUS) and dual energy X-ray absorptiometry (DXA) for determining bone mineral density (BMD) among children living with HIV (CLWH) who were switching to second-line antiretroviral therapy (ART).
Methods
We conducted a cross-sectional study among CLWH as a sub-study of the CHAPAS-4 trial. Total body less head (TBLH) BMD and lumbar spine (LS) BMD were determined by DXA while the sound of speed (SOS), broad band ultrasound attenuation (BUA) and bone quality index (BQI) were determined by QUS. We evaluated the correlation between the DXA and QUS measurements using spearman correlation coefficient.
Results
A total of 167 children were enrolled; the median age was 9.4 (interquartile range = 6.0–12.0) years. Eighty-five (50.9%) were male. The median weight- for- age Z- score (IQR) was − 1.29(-2.16, -0.49) and height for age Z-score was − 1.03(-1.56, 0.01). SOS was weakly correlated with TBLH BMD

Conclusion
In CLWH, there was moderate correlation observed for TBLH measurements when comparing DXA to QUS, and weak correlation was found between LSBMAD and QUS measurements. There was a moderate correlation detected between the LSBMC and QUS.QUS may not be an appropriate substitute for DXA scan.

Background. Recent evidence suggests that decreases in morbidity and mortality in cohorts of adults infected with human immunodeficiency virus (HIV) are showing signs of reversal. We describe changes over time in these characteristics and in the response to treatment among children in the United Kingdom and Ireland with perinatally acquired HIV infection, many of whom are now adolescents. Methods. We analyzed prospective cohort data reported to the National Study of HIV in Pregnancy and Childhood (NSHPC) and the Collaborative HIV Paediatric Study. Results. By mid 2006, 1441 HIV-infected children were reported to NSHPC; 40% were ⩾10 years old at their most recent follow-up visit, and 34% were receiving care outside London. The proportion of children born abroad increased from 24% during 1994–1996 to 64% during 2003–2006. The percentage of total child time during which children received highly active antiretroviral therapy (HAART) increased from 36% during 1997–1999 to 61% during 2000–2002 and 63% during 2003–2006. Of children who were naive to antiretroviral therapy at the start of HAART, the percentage with an HIV-1 RNA load of <400 copies/mL after 12 months increased from 52% during 1997–1999 to 79% during 2003–2006. In multivariate analysis, only calendar time predicted virological response, whereas both younger age and lower CD4 cell percentage at HAART initiation predicted increases of >10% in the CD4 cell percentage. A total of 31% of children aged 5–14 years and 38% aged ⩾15 years at their most recent follow-up visit had been exposed to drugs from each of the 3 main HAART classes. The rate of AIDS and mortality combined decreased from 13.3 cases per 100 person-years before 1997 to 3.1 and 2.5 cases per 100 person-years, respectively, during 2000–2002 and 2003–2006; rates of hospital admission also declined during this interval. Of 18 children known to have died since 2003, 9 died within 1 month after presentation. Conclusions. Morbidity and mortality rates among HIV-infected children continue to decrease over time. Because these children are increasingly dispersed outside London, specialist care is now provided in national clinical networks. Transition pathways to adolescent and adult services and long-term observation to monitor the effects of prolonged exposure to both HIV and HAART are required.

In this clinical trial of second-line antiretroviral therapy in children with HIV in Africa, regimens including tenofovir alafenamide fumarate as the backbone and dolutegravir as the anchor drug were most effective.

Little evidence is available on the pharmacokinetics of antituberculous medication in premature infants. We report rifampicin (RMP) pharmacokinetics in an extremely premature, low-birthweight female infant born to a mother with known miliary tuberculosis. Intravenous RMP, isoniazid (INH), ciprofloxacin and amikacin were used, as the enteral route was not possible. Area under the curve calculations revealed low average RMP concentrations at doses of 5–10 mg/kg. We review the literature with regard to the dosing regimen and therapeutic drug levels of RMP and INH in premature infants and discuss issues of management. Evidence from this case suggests 10 mg/kg/day is the minimum dose required.
